Structural operational semantics is a simple, yet powerful mathematical theory for describing the behaviour of programs in an implementation-independent manner. This book provides a self-contained introduction to structural operational semantics, featuring semantic definitions using big-step and small-step semantics of many standard programming language constructs, including control structures, structured declarations and objects, parameter mechanisms and procedural abstraction, concurrency, nondeterminism and the features of functional programming languages. Along the way, the text introduces and applies the relevant proof techniques, including forms of induction and notions of semantic equivalence (including bisimilarity). Thoroughly class-tested, this book has evolved from lecture notes used by the author over a 10-year period at Aalborg University to teach undergraduate and graduate students. The result is a thorough introduction that makes the subject clear to students and computing professionals without sacrificing its rigour. No experience with any specific programming language is required.
"synopsis" may belong to another edition of this title.
Hans Hüttel is Associate Professor in the Department of Computer Science at Aalborg University, Denmark.
"About this title" may belong to another edition of this title.
Seller: Ria Christie Collections, Uxbridge, United Kingdom
Condition: New. In. Seller Inventory # ria9780521197465_new
Quantity: Over 20 available
Seller: Revaluation Books, Exeter, United Kingdom
Hardcover. Condition: Brand New. 1st edition. 260 pages. 9.61x6.77x0.79 inches. In Stock. This item is printed on demand. Seller Inventory # __0521197465
Quantity: 1 available
Seller: Kennys Bookshop and Art Galleries Ltd., Galway, GY, Ireland
Condition: New. A rigorous, self-contained introduction to the theory of operational semantics of programming languages and its use. Num Pages: 290 pages, 25 b/w illus. 75 tables 85 exercises. BIC Classification: UMB; UMJ. Category: (UP) Postgraduate, Research & Scholarly; (UU) Undergraduate. Dimension: 247 x 174 x 19. Weight in Grams: 670. . 2010. New. hardcover. . . . . Seller Inventory # V9780521197465
Quantity: Over 20 available
Seller: THE SAINT BOOKSTORE, Southport, United Kingdom
Hardback. Condition: New. This item is printed on demand. New copy - Usually dispatched within 5-9 working days. Seller Inventory # C9780521197465
Quantity: Over 20 available
Seller: Books Puddle, New York, NY, U.S.A.
Condition: New. pp. 290. Seller Inventory # 26609558
Seller: Kennys Bookstore, Olney, MD, U.S.A.
Condition: New. A rigorous, self-contained introduction to the theory of operational semantics of programming languages and its use. Num Pages: 290 pages, 25 b/w illus. 75 tables 85 exercises. BIC Classification: UMB; UMJ. Category: (UP) Postgraduate, Research & Scholarly; (UU) Undergraduate. Dimension: 247 x 174 x 19. Weight in Grams: 670. . 2010. New. hardcover. . . . . Books ship from the US and Ireland. Seller Inventory # V9780521197465
Seller: CitiRetail, Stevenage, United Kingdom
Hardcover. Condition: new. Hardcover. Structural operational semantics is a simple, yet powerful mathematical theory for describing the behaviour of programs in an implementation-independent manner. This book provides a self-contained introduction to structural operational semantics, featuring semantic definitions using big-step and small-step semantics of many standard programming language constructs, including control structures, structured declarations and objects, parameter mechanisms and procedural abstraction, concurrency, nondeterminism and the features of functional programming languages. Along the way, the text introduces and applies the relevant proof techniques, including forms of induction and notions of semantic equivalence (including bisimilarity). Thoroughly class-tested, this book has evolved from lecture notes used by the author over a 10-year period at Aalborg University to teach undergraduate and graduate students. The result is a thorough introduction that makes the subject clear to students and computing professionals without sacrificing its rigour. No experience with any specific programming language is required. A rigorous, self-contained introduction to structural operational semantics and how to use it to describe, reason about and assist the implementation of features found in common programming languages. The author assumes no experience with any specific programming language, making the book easily accessible to students and computing professionals. This item is printed on demand. Shipping may be from our UK warehouse or from our Australian or US warehouses, depending on stock availability. Seller Inventory # 9780521197465
Quantity: 1 available
Seller: Majestic Books, Hounslow, United Kingdom
Condition: New. Print on Demand pp. 290 25 Illus. Seller Inventory # 8319689
Quantity: 4 available
Seller: moluna, Greven, Germany
Gebunden. Condition: New. Dieser Artikel ist ein Print on Demand Artikel und wird nach Ihrer Bestellung fuer Sie gedruckt. A rigorous, self-contained introduction to structural operational semantics and how to use it to describe, reason about and assist the implementation of features found in common programming languages. The author assumes no experience with any specific progr. Seller Inventory # 446929706
Quantity: Over 20 available
Seller: Grand Eagle Retail, Bensenville, IL, U.S.A.
Hardcover. Condition: new. Hardcover. Structural operational semantics is a simple, yet powerful mathematical theory for describing the behaviour of programs in an implementation-independent manner. This book provides a self-contained introduction to structural operational semantics, featuring semantic definitions using big-step and small-step semantics of many standard programming language constructs, including control structures, structured declarations and objects, parameter mechanisms and procedural abstraction, concurrency, nondeterminism and the features of functional programming languages. Along the way, the text introduces and applies the relevant proof techniques, including forms of induction and notions of semantic equivalence (including bisimilarity). Thoroughly class-tested, this book has evolved from lecture notes used by the author over a 10-year period at Aalborg University to teach undergraduate and graduate students. The result is a thorough introduction that makes the subject clear to students and computing professionals without sacrificing its rigour. No experience with any specific programming language is required. A rigorous, self-contained introduction to structural operational semantics and how to use it to describe, reason about and assist the implementation of features found in common programming languages. The author assumes no experience with any specific programming language, making the book easily accessible to students and computing professionals. This item is printed on demand. Shipping may be from multiple locations in the US or from the UK, depending on stock availability. Seller Inventory # 9780521197465